Output 21603724813d3020f18e1863ae9adf71206141e89905809c21de69bb6c574530:0

value
27682075
script pubkey
OP_0 OP_PUSHBYTES_20 4c3b1c6a90636caf974c87ea50e7802e04b89d84
address
ltc1qfsa3c65svdk2l96vsl49peuq9czt38vys6rvf6
transaction
21603724813d3020f18e1863ae9adf71206141e89905809c21de69bb6c574530
spent
true